Constructing Tumor Immune Microenvironment and Identifying the Immune-Related Prognostic Signatures in Colorectal Cancer Using Multi-omics Data

The tumor immune microenvironment (TIME) plays a key role in occurrence, progression and prognosis of colorectal cancer (CRC). However, the genetic and epigenetic alterations and potential mechanisms in the TIME of CRC are still unclear.We investigated the immune-related differences in three types of genetic or epigenetic alterations (gene expression, somatic mutation, and DNA methylation) and considered the potential roles that these alterations have in the immune response and the immune-related biological processes by analyzing the multi-omics data from The Cancer Genome Atlas (TCGA) portal. Additionally, a four-step method based on LASSO regression and Cox regression was used to construct the prognostic prediction model. Cross validation was performed to validate the model.A total of 1,745 differentially expressed genes, 178 differentially mutated genes and 1,961 differentially methylation probes were identified between the high-immunity group and the low-immunity group. We retained 15 genetic and epigenetic variables after using LASSO regression and Cox regression. For the prognostic predictions on the TCGA profiles, the performance of the model with 1-year, 3-year, and 5-year areas under the curve (AUCs) equal to 0.861, 0.797, and 0.875. Finally, the overall risk score model was constructed based on genetic, epigenetic, demographic and clinical characteristics, which comprised 18 variables and achieved a high degree of accuracy on the 1-year (AUC = 0.865), 3-year (AUC = 0.839), and 5-year (AUC = 0.914) survival predictions. Kaplan-Meier survival analysis demonstrated that the overall survival of the high-risk group was significantly poorer compared with the low-risk group. Prognostic nomogram, calibration plot and cross validation showed excellent predictive performance.Our study provides a new clue to explore the TIME of CRC patients in genetic and epigenetic aspects. Meanwhile, the prognostic model also has clinical prognostic value and may provide new indicators for the treatment of CRC patients.
